Output 59e544632fc6bfef87872ed586289375361ea262c5857cef33e85bc94f6e34e2:19

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3343369972dd373af0180007e78de5ead6b2f99ca836232fe546bd92e5dd4d0d
address
bc1pxdpndxtjm5mn4uqcqqr70r09attt97vu4qmzxtl9g67e9ewaf5xsavz3r8
transaction
59e544632fc6bfef87872ed586289375361ea262c5857cef33e85bc94f6e34e2
spent
false